Rockwell Hardness Tester

Lab Expo Rockwell Hardness Tester units are used for hardness determination of metallic materials under controlled indentation loads. Systems support initial test forces from 3 kgf to 10 kgf with total test forces reaching 150 kgf across standard and superficial Rockwell scales including HRA, HRB, HRC, HR15N, and HR45N. Configurations are structured for repeatable hardness evaluation in metallurgical analysis, production inspection, heat treatment verification, and material quality control workflows.

FAQ for Rockwell Hardness Tester

1: What is the advantage of having multiple test force options in a Rockwell Hardness Tester?

Multiple test force options allow the tester to evaluate a wide range of materials from soft metals to hard alloys, by selecting the appropriate scale and force for accurate and reliable hardness measurements.

2: What is the benefit of an automatic load application system in a Rockwell Hardness Tester?

The automatic system ensures that the test load is applied uniformly each time, reducing human error and improving the consistency and repeatability of hardness measurements.
